package com.basic.security.manager;
|
|
import com.basic.security.model.ModelAdapter;
|
|
import java.util.ArrayList;
|
import java.util.List;
|
|
/**
|
* 业务表Manager
|
*/
|
public class BusinessListManager extends BaseManager {
|
static long getBusinessListLastTime = System.currentTimeMillis();
|
static List<ModelAdapter> getBusinessListLastList = new ArrayList<>();
|
|
// 获取所有的业务表
|
public static List<ModelAdapter> getBusinessList() {
|
long getBusinessListCurrentTime = System.currentTimeMillis();
|
// if (getBusinessListCurrentTime - getBusinessListLastTime > 5 * 1000) {
|
getBusinessListLastList = findList("select * from business where del_flag='0'");
|
getBusinessListLastTime = getBusinessListCurrentTime;
|
// }
|
// if (getBusinessListLastList.size() > 0) {
|
// for (int i = 0; i < 10; i++) {
|
// getBusinessListLastList.add(getBusinessListLastList.get(0));
|
// }
|
// }
|
return getBusinessListLastList;
|
}
|
|
// 删除某个业务表
|
public static void deleteBusiness(ModelAdapter business) {
|
try {
|
deletePhysically(findById("business", business.getId()));
|
} catch (Exception e) {
|
e.printStackTrace();
|
}
|
}
|
}
|